- Julie (10/5): Fabulous! - We absolutely loved this apartment and felt very at home there, it was super clean throughout with nice little touches such as coffee/oil and some toiletries. The location was great, a 10 minute walk over the bridge and into the main part of the city and 20/25 minute walk to the beach, 15 minutes to the train station and 2 minutes to the bus stop, a large mercadona supermarket is 10 minute walk away. The apartment itself was quiet and peaceful on the 3rd floor (there is a lift) with a comfortable bed in a large bedroom (aircon in both main rooms but never needed it) with loads of wardrobe space and drawers, a cute galley style kitchen with everything you could need ( although eating out in Malaga is a must) with a utility area and washing machine, we asked for a few cleaning products and our host obliged. It also has a lovely terrace with comfortable furniture which we enjoyed with a glass of wine after a hard day on the beach or sightseeing. There is also a nice bathroom with a shower (the shower is quite small but fine for us) a bidet, basin and toilet - and plenty of shelves to put toiletries. The lounge is quite spacious with a comfortable sofa and a 4 place dining room set and a huge TV. The apartment was very quiet we only heard our neighbours once playing the acoustic guitar which was actually lovely. We stayed for 2 weeks and thoroughly enjoyed it, Dora was a superb host and I have no hesitation in recommending this apartment for both long and short stays in Malaga. Nothing, we loved it!
